[Chicago:: Edward G. Heeman,, 1914].. First edition.. publisher's limp suede, yapp-edged, gilt-lettered with a gilt-stamped baseball and the original owner's name, a sports editor, gilt-lettered on the front panel; preserved in a custom cloth folding box. . Lacks pp. 30-31. Leaves a little cockled and darkly stained at the fore-edge margin; some minor marginal damage from leaves having been stuck together, affecting no printing; the fragile binding in very nice condition. . Oblong large 8vo,. Illustrated throughout from photographs and drawings. . Ring Lardner was the co-compiler and contributed a foreword; his second book after the script Zanzibar (1903). "This book is in every sense a souvenir of the occasion, and under no conditions for sale."
